What is a Leadership Associate Program?

A Leadership Associate Program is a structured rotational program offered by companies to develop future leaders. Participants, often recent graduates or early-career professionals, rotate through various departments or roles to gain broad exposure to the organization. The program typically includes mentorship, training, and networking opportunities designed to accelerate career growth. Upon completion, associates are usually placed in leadership roles within the company. These programs are highly competitive and aim to cultivate strategic thinking and management skills.

What types of projects and responsibilities can I expect in a Leadership Associate Program?

As a participant in a Leadership Associate Program, you will typically rotate through several departments or business units to gain hands-on experience in various aspects of the organization. Your responsibilities may include leading cross-functional projects, analyzing business processes, and presenting strategic recommendations to senior leaders. These programs often emphasize leadership development through mentorship, formal training sessions, and real-world problem solving. You can expect to collaborate closely with team members across departments, which helps build a broad professional network and prepares you for future management roles.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in a Leadership Associate Program?

To thrive in a Leadership Associate Program, you typically need a bachelor's degree, strong analytical skills, and a demonstrated track record of leadership potential. Familiarity with project management tools, data analysis platforms, and pro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ite are often expected. Outstanding communication, adaptability, and teamwork skills help participants excel and stand out in collaborative, fast-paced environments. These skills and qualities are vital for developing future leaders who can drive organizational success and navigate complex business challenges.

What is the difference between Leadership Associate Program vs Leadership Development Program?

AspectLeadership Associate ProgramLeadership Development Program
CredentialsTypically requires a bachelor's degree, sometimes an internship or related experienceOften requires a bachelor's or master's degree, with focus on leadership potential
Work EnvironmentStructured rotational program within a company, often in corporate officesVaries; may include training sessions, workshops, and project work in corporate or organizational settings
Employer & Industry UsageCommon in large corporations across industries like finance, consulting, and techUsed in various industries for developing future leaders, including non-profits and government

The Leadership Associate Program is a structured entry-level program designed to develop future leaders through rotations and training within a company. Leadership Development Programs are broader initiatives aimed at enhancing leadership skills across different levels and industries. While both focus on leadership growth, the Associate Program is more structured and entry-focused, whereas Development Programs may target a wider audience and career stages.

Your role and responsibilities

As an Associate Application Consultant at IBM you will help us usher clients into a new age of future-looking technology. You'll be assisting clients in the selection, implementation, and support of applications, methodology, and tools. You'll be trained up to perform as an expert on existing and/or new applications specialized around things like Cloud, DevOp, Enterprise Applications, and Mobile. You will help our clients integrate enterprise-wide data for improved performance and efficiency. Leveraging a growth mindset, you're ready and willing to deliver business value, wherever needed.

In your role you may be responsible for:

  • Working with project teams to advise clients on enterprise-wide data integrations.
  • Creating ways to better assess analytics, better supporting business decisionmaking.
  • Work as a team member with client personnel and other IBM teams to identify functional requirements and subsequently working with or in some instances leading others in the identification, justification, and design of the client's solution.
  • Participate in a wide range of design activities, from requirements analysis through systems, application and/or process design specification and implementation.
  • Gain knowledge across multiple platforms, processes, or architectures
